Inflight Catering · Dawson Creek

Inflight catering for Dawson Creek flights

Dawson Creek sits at the southern end of the Alaska Highway, a working town built on grain, oil, and the kind of self-reliance that defines the Peace Country. That character shapes how we source here: regional producers across the Peace River corridor supply heritage grains, cold-climate root vegetables, and locally pressed canola oils that carry a genuinely distinct flavour profile. The surrounding agricultural belt — stretching toward Fort St John and the Grande Prairie plain — is one of Canada's northernmost grain-producing regions, which means crews departing YDQ can board with provisions that reflect the landscape beneath them rather than a generic hotel menu.

Regional Catering Menu · Dawson Creek

Dawson Creek private jet catering

Peace Country beef and bison feature prominently in our Dawson Creek builds. Both are raised on open pasture at high elevation and arrive with a clean, mineral-forward depth that lends itself to slow-braised preparations, chilled sliced presentations, and rich reduction sauces equally well. We pair them with roasted root vegetables — parsnip, celeriac, heritage carrot — sourced from farms within the region. For lighter boards and morning services, we draw on wild-foraged items when seasonal availability permits: spruce-tip oils, fireweed honey, and dried saskatoon berries. These are not decorative gestures; they are ingredients with real flavour that distinguish a Dawson Creek tray from anything assembled in a southern commissary.
